Oil Seal (Differential) Replacement

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2005 Mazda 6.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. On level ground, jack up the vehicle and support it evenly on safety stands.
  2. Drain the oil from the transaxle.
  3. Remove the front wheels and splash shields.
  4. Separate the drive shaft and joint shaft from the transaxle. (See DRIVE SHAFT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ION [L3] .) (See JOINT SHAFT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ION [L3] .)
  5. Remove the oil seals using a screwdriver.

  6. Using the SST  and a hammer, tap each new oil seal in evenly until the SST  contacts the transaxle case.

  7. Coat the lip of each oil seal with transaxle oil.
  8. Insert the drive shaft and joint shaft to the transaxle. (See DRIVE SHAFT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ION [L3] .) (See JOINT SHAFT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ION [L3] .)
  9. Install the wheels and splash shields.
  10. Add the specified amount and type of oil. (See TRANSAXLE OIL REPLACEMENT .)
